DataV offers visual editing tools, geographic information visualization, and flexible publishing and deployment options.
Data visualization editing tools
-
Drag-and-drop visual editor
Offers non-chart components such as maps, information, tables, and controls with WYSIWYG configuration. Build visualization applications through drag-and-drop.
-
Component and template libraries
Provide retail, industrial, Internet of Things, medical and cloud computing kind of scene template , enabling quick deployment with minimal changes. Build dashboards without a designer.
-
Intelligent tools
Provide intelligent theme color matching, one-click beautification, large screen intelligent generation and other toolsto resolve style configuration challenges when building visualization applications.
Geographic information visualization
-
Geographic information components
Supports geographic trajectories, flying lines, thermal distribution, and 3D globe effects for spatial data visualization and analysis.
-
Data-driven 3D world generation
Provide three-dimensional city functions such as official base, space construction and model building, which ingests structured urban geographic data to generate data-driven The City Model city models automatically.
-
Low-code interactive feature development
Provides a simple way to configure the interaction between components, so that complex interaction logic is visualized and easier to maintain.
Flexible publishing and deployment
-
Multiple publishing methods
Provides multiple publishing methods such as publishing links and QR code sharing, and combines access control to specify the content to be viewed by visitors.
-
Custom components
Provides developer tools to quickly develop custom components based on the component specifications of DataV to meet individual requirements.
-
Flexible deployment methods
Supports cloud and on-premises deployment. Package and download cloud-deployed content to your local network.
